面对系统安装不兼容的问题,用户可能会感到困惑和不安,不必过于担心,因为解决方案总是存在的,需要仔细检查安装的操作系统与硬件设备的兼容性,确保两者能够和谐共存,这通常涉及到对操作系统的版本、驱动程序以及硬件要求的深入了解。如果发现系统与硬件之间存在不兼容的情况,可以尝试更新硬件驱动程序,驱动程序是连接硬件和操作系统的桥梁,更新它们有时可以解决兼容性问题。还可以考虑更换硬件设备或者调整系统设置来适应现有的硬件环境,这可能需要一定的技术知识,但通常都是可行的。系统安装不兼容并非不可解决的问题,通过检查和更新驱动程序、更换硬件或调整系统设置,大多数兼容性问题都能得到妥善解决,如果问题依然存在,建议寻求专业技术人员的帮助,他们能够提供更具体的解决方案。
在数字化时代,电脑已成为我们生活和工作中不可或缺的工具,在安装操作系统时,我们经常会遇到各种兼容性问题,让原本愉快的装机过程变得紧张不安,就让我来给大家聊聊,当系统安装遇到不兼容问题时,我们应该如何应对和解决。
什么是系统安装不兼容?
系统安装不兼容就是指你尝试安装的操作系统与你的硬件设备、软件环境之间存在不匹配的情况,这种不匹配可能会导致安装失败、系统运行不稳定,甚至数据丢失等问题。
为什么会出现系统安装不兼容?
-
硬件兼容性问题:你的电脑硬件可能过于陈旧或不符合新系统的要求。
-
软件兼容性问题:某些软件可能与新系统不兼容,导致安装失败。
-
驱动程序问题:缺少必要的驱动程序也会导致系统安装不兼容。
如何解决系统安装不兼容问题?
检查硬件兼容性
你需要检查你的电脑硬件是否满足新系统的最低要求,可以参考操作系统官方文档中的硬件兼容性列表(HCL)。
硬件组件 | 最低要求 |
---|---|
CPU | 支持新系统的最低型号 |
内存 | 至少8GB RAM |
存储空间 | 至少256GB SSD |
显卡 | 如果需要图形加速,确保显卡支持 |
如果你的硬件不满足这些要求,那么可能需要考虑升级硬件或更换为兼容的硬件。
更新或卸载不兼容的软件
在安装新系统之前,最好先卸载所有不兼容的软件,这可以避免在安装过程中出现软件冲突。
软件类型 | 卸载建议 |
---|---|
应用程序 | 使用控制面板或软件卸载工具进行卸载 |
系统工具 | 在安装新系统后重新安装必要的系统工具 |
安装或更新驱动程序
驱动程序是电脑与硬件之间的桥梁,确保安装正确的驱动程序至关重要。
驱动程序类型 | 安装/更新建议 |
---|---|
显示卡驱动 | 访问显卡制造商官网下载最新驱动程序 |
网络适配器驱动 | 使用设备管理器自动检测并安装驱动程序 |
音频驱动 | 尝试使用操作系统自带的音频驱动,或在设备管理器中手动安装 |
案例说明
小张最近想安装一个新的操作系统,但他发现自己的电脑配置较低,无法满足新系统的最低要求,通过查阅资料,他了解到自己的电脑内存只有4GB,而新系统至少需要8GB RAM。
小张决定升级自己的内存条,经过一番努力,他成功地将内存条升级到8GB,并重新安装了新系统,他的电脑运行流畅,完全满足了日常工作的需求。
系统安装不兼容虽然会让人头疼,但只要掌握一些方法,就能轻松解决,要检查硬件兼容性,确保硬件满足新系统的要求;及时更新或卸载不兼容的软件;安装或更新驱动程序,通过这些步骤,相信你一定能够顺利安装操作系统,享受科技带来的便利。
呼吁
在面对系统安装不兼容问题时,不要慌张,只要冷静分析原因,采取合适的解决方法,就一定能够克服困难,也要注意在安装过程中保护好个人数据和隐私安全,希望本文能为大家提供一些有益的参考和帮助,在数字化时代中更好地应对各种挑战!
知识扩展阅读
常见安装不兼容场景大揭秘(附真实案例)
1 操作系统版本错乱
- 案例:某程序员尝试在Windows 10上安装Python 3.9(仅支持Win11/WSL2)
- 典型症状:安装包直接弹窗"不兼容"或卡在进度30%就崩溃
2 硬件配置不达标
- 案例:游戏玩家在GTX 1660显卡上安装《赛博朋克2077》引发蓝屏
- 关键参数:内存<8GB、存储<256GB、CPU架构不匹配
3 驱动程序冲突
- 案例:设计师在安装Adobe全家桶时遭遇显卡驱动冲突
- 常见冲突点:NVIDIA 450.80与Adobe CC 2024版本
冲突类型 | 典型表现 | 解决优先级 |
---|---|---|
系统版本 | 安装包直接拦截 | |
硬件配置 | 进度卡死/蓝屏 | |
驱动冲突 | 程序闪退/黑屏 |
4步诊断法锁定问题根源
1 第一步:安装环境快速扫描
- Windows:运行
msiinfo.exe
查看安装包签名状态 - macOS:终端执行
spctl --master -v
- Linux:
rpm -q <软件名>
或dpkg -s <软件名>
2 第二步:硬件兼容性核查
- CPU架构:Win+R →services.msc →右键Windows Update启动 →查看"Windows Update"服务属性
- 内存型号:任务管理器→性能→内存→高级→物理内存
- 存储类型:右键C盘→属性→工具→优化存储空间→容量和分配
3 第三步:驱动版本比对
- 显卡驱动:NVIDIA控制面板→系统信息→驱动版本
- 芯片组:设备管理器→计算机→高级→系统类型
- 虚拟化支持:
powershell -Command "Get-WmiObject Win32_CIMInstance | Where-Object { $_.Properties.Name -match ' гипертекст' }"
(需Win10+)
4 第四步:环境变量检查
- Python环境:检查
python --version
和pip list
- Node.js环境:
node -v
和npm -v
- Docker环境:
docker --version
和docker run hello-world
8大解决方案实战教学
1 轻量级方案:容器化运行
- Docker:
docker run --gpus all -it python:3.9-slim
- LXC:
lxc launch images:ubuntu:22.04 --config security.nesting=1
- 对比表:
方案 | 优点 | 缺点 | 适用场景 |
---|---|---|---|
Docker | 灵活配置 | 资源占用高 | 多环境并存 |
LXC | 硬件隔离好 | 学习曲线陡 | 安全敏感场景 |
WSL2 | 兼容性佳 | 驱动适配慢 | Windows原生开发 |
2 进阶方案:虚拟机迁移
- VMware Workstation:
vmware-vphere-vclient.exe
安装客户端 - VirtualBox:
OracleVMVirtualBox-6.1.30-1.exe
安装包 - 迁移步骤:
- 原生环境安装虚拟机软件
- 创建新虚拟机(选择目标系统镜像)
- 使用"文件→导入现有虚拟机"功能
- 调整共享文件夹设置
3 系统级优化:兼容模式
- Windows:右键安装包→属性→兼容性→高级→设置兼容模式
- macOS:安装包右键→显示包内容→信息→最小系统要求
- Linux:
chmod +x
后执行./install.sh --force
4 驱动级解决方案
- Windows:
dism /online /cleanup-image /restorehealth sfc /scannow
- macOS:通过App Store更新系统到最新版本
- Linux:使用
apt-get install --reinstall nvidia-driver
5 环境变量重置
- Python:
python -m ensurepip --upgrade pip install --upgrade pip setuptools wheel
- Node.js:
npm install -g @types/node npm install -g typescript
6 系统架构调整
- x86_64 vs ARM:
- Windows:设置→系统→Windows版本→高级系统设置→处理器
- macOS:终端执行
swatch -s
- Linux:
uname -m
7 硬件桥接方案
- 显卡:使用PCIe转接卡(如ASUS ROG XG-C100C)
- 存储:RAID 0配置(需SSD)
- 网络:Intel I210-T1网卡驱动更新
8 终极方案:系统重装
- Windows:使用媒体创建工具生成启动盘
- macOS:通过恢复模式重装
- Linux:
sudo apt install --reinstall initramfs
20个高频问题Q&A
Q1:如何检查系统是否支持目标软件?
A:访问软件官网的"系统要求"页面,重点关注:
- 操作系统版本(如macOS 10.15+)
- CPU架构(Intel/Apple Silicon)
- 内存/存储最低配置
Q2:安装包提示"无法运行"怎么办?
A:依次尝试:
- 更新系统补丁(Windows Update)
- 检查安装包MD5校验
- 使用行政账户运行
- 下载最新安装包
Q3:虚拟机运行时出现"虚拟化未启用"?
A:Windows:
- BIOS设置→处理器→虚拟化技术→开启
- 系统属性→高级→启动设置→重启后按F4
- 任务管理器→服务→Windows Hyper-V→启动
Q4:Docker容器卡在"Starting"状态?
A:执行:
docker system prune -f docker-compose down docker-compose up --build
Q5:游戏安装失败提示"DXDIAG报错"?
A:按Win+R→dxdiag→输出结果中检查:
- Direct3D版本(需11.0+)
- dxgi.dll路径
- 检查显卡驱动是否为32位
相关的知识点: